SITE NOTICE

Harpenden Cricket Club have applied to the Secretary of State for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s for consent under section 38 of the Commons Act 2006/section 23(2) of the National Trust Act 1971 to carry out restricted works on East Common. The Planning Inspectorate will decide the application on behalf of the Secretary of State.

The proposals comprise two cricket lanes totalling approximately 219 sqm in land take which includes 85.4 sqm of new matting. The new nets measure 30m in length, 7.3m in width and 4m in height representing a minor area of open space. The enclosure, which measures 133.6 sqm, will be formed using a galvanized steel post system standing at 4 metres in height with the individual cricket lanes formed with a woven netting. The ground surface will comprise a green carpet over a hardcore base. The works will be located at Harpenden Cricket Club, East Common, Harpenden, Hertfordshire, AL5 1DT
